À propos de cet audio
Immerse yourself in contemporary Melbourne, the beautiful bay, magnificent parks and the diversity of people. Real people, gentle people and not so gentle people.
Take your seat at the MCG and gasp at the tenacity of Jasper P Clarke as he nails a critical mark and kicks a winning goal.
Observe Justine and her father as they barrack with intensity and knowledge, joining the Collingwood cheer squad in celebratory song.
Cheer with Justine and Jasper as they combine their integrity, skills and love to fight for what is right and to right wrongs.
Allow the characters in this carefully crafted novel to engage you, encourage you to celebrate life and be perturbed by its uncanny ugliness. This is story for now, showcasing current issues that often seep into global cities all grounded in believable and entertaining characters. This is a novel that showcases Melbourne, its iconic character and significant challenges.
Be gripped by the final scenes and left to ponder, is good genuinely triumphing over evil.
Enjoy the compelling narration by the author and the musical compositions of some talented musicians.
